SUBJECT: LITHUANIAN RESPONSE TO NIGHT VISION DEVICES ROADMAP 
 
REF: SECSTATE 80617 
 
Classified By: Political/Economic Officer Alexander Titolo for reasons 
1.4 (b) & (d) 
 
(C) We delivered reftel points regarding Night Vision Devices 
on May 6 to Gediminas Varvuolis, Head of the MFA's NATO 
Division, Alvydas Kunigelis, Acting Director of the MOD's 
Department of International Relations, and LTC Gintautas 
Zinkevicius, Commander of the Lithuanian-led PRT deploying to 
Chaghcharan, Afghanistan.  Zinkevicius said that he hopes to 
move to the "smartest technology" in the future, but that for 
the time being the 1250 FOM NVD's that Lithuanian PRT members 
plan to use, but have still not formally requested, are 
"smart enough."  Zinkevicius and Varvuolis expressed 
satisfaction in having a defined nine-month timetable and 
clear roadmap to follow in order to demonstrate their ability 
to handle the more sophisticated technology responsibly.
